The Opportunity

As an IT Support & Systems Intern, you'll gain exposure to a broad range of technologies while supporting users across the business. You'll develop practical experience in Microsoft cloud services, endpoint management, networking, cybersecurity, device deployment, and IT operations.

You'll work closely with colleagues from multiple departments, helping to improve technology processes while building the technical and professional skills expected of a modern IT professional.

Key Responsibilities

Technical Support

  • Deliver first and second-line technical support to employees across multiple locations.
  • Diagnose and resolve hardware, software, networking, and peripheral issues.
  • Manage incidents and service requests while maintaining excellent customer service.
  • Escalate complex issues appropriately while taking ownership of resolutions.

Cloud & Microsoft 365 Administration

  • Assist with Microsoft 365 administration, including Exchange Online, Teams, SharePoint, and OneDrive.
  • Provision and deprovision user accounts, licenses, and permissions.
  • Support identity and access management through Microsoft Entra ID.
  • Assist with mailbox management and collaboration tools.

Endpoint Management

  • Configure, deploy, and maintain Windows laptops and mobile devices.
  • Assist with device lifecycle management and inventory control.
  • Support endpoint security, updates, encryption, and compliance.
  • Help maintain standardised device builds and deployment processes.

Infrastructure & Networking

  • Assist with maintaining local networks, Wi-Fi connectivity, VPN access, and printers.
  • Support troubleshooting of connectivity and infrastructure issues.
  • Gain exposure to firewalls, switches, routers, and cloud networking concepts.

Cybersecurity

  • Support cybersecurity initiatives including endpoint protection, multi-factor authentication, and security awareness.
  • Assist with vulnerability remediation and security best practices.
  • Help maintain compliance with organisational IT policies.
  • Participate in routine security monitoring and documentation.

IT Projects

You'll have the opportunity to contribute to projects such as:

  • Microsoft 365 optimisation
  • Device refresh and deployment programmes
  • Automation using PowerShell and Microsoft Power Platform
  • Documentation improvements
  • IT asset management
  • Process automation
  • Business system implementations
  • Digital transformation initiatives
  • AI
    • AI-powered workflow automation
    • Microsoft Copilot implementation
    • Evaluation and deployment of AI tools across the business
    • Automation using AI and Power Platform

About You

We're looking for someone who is naturally inquisitive, enjoys solving technical challenges, and is eager to build a career in IT.

You may have recently completed a degree, diploma, apprenticeship, or equivalent qualification in:

  • Computer Science
  • Information Technology
  • Cyber Security
  • Software Engineering
  • Information Systems
  • Network Engineering
  • A related technology discipline

Equivalent practical experience or demonstrable personal projects are also welcomed.

Essential Skills

  • Strong understanding of Windows 10/11.
  • Familiarity with Microsoft 365 applications and cloud services.
  • Basic knowledge of networking concepts including TCP/IP, DNS, DHCP, and Wi-Fi.
  • Understanding of computer hardware and operating systems.
  • Excellent troubleshooting and analytical skills.
  • Strong written and verbal communication.
  • Excellent organisational skills and attention to detail.
  • Ability to prioritise multiple tasks in a fast-paced environment.
  • A proactive mindset with a willingness to learn new technologies.

Desirable Skills

Experience with any of the following would be advantageous:

  • Microsoft Entra ID (Azure AD)
  • Active Directory
  • Intune / Microsoft Endpoint Manager
  • PowerShell scripting
  • Windows Server
  • Microsoft Defender
  • SharePoint Online
  • ITIL Foundation
  • ServiceNow, Notion, or similar IT service management and knowledge management platforms
  • Networking equipment (Cisco, Ubiquiti, Fortinet, Aruba, etc.)
  • Power BI or Microsoft Power Platform
  • Basic SQL knowledge

What We Offer

  • Real-world experience within a growing healthcare organisation.
  • Exposure to enterprise technologies and cloud platforms.
  • Mentoring from experienced IT professionals.
  • Opportunities to work on meaningful technology projects.
  • Continuous learning and professional development.
  • A collaborative and supportive working environment.
  • Modern office located in Central London.
  • Flexible part-time schedule of up to 20 hours per week.

Why Join Virtue Vets?

At Virtue Vets, technology is central to delivering outstanding veterinary care. You'll be joining a forward-thinking organisation where your ideas, curiosity, and technical ability will be valued from day one.

If you're looking for more than a standard internship, one where you'll gain exposure to cloud technologies, cybersecurity, infrastructure, digital transformation, and enterprise IT operations, this is an excellent opportunity to launch your career alongside an experienced and supportive team.
